If you’ve noticed a mole that’s changed shape, a sore on your foot that won’t heal, or a dark streak under a toenail, you’re right to pay attention. Foot cancer symptoms include new or changing moles, non-healing ulcers, unexplained lumps or swelling, persistent pain, and discoloration under the nail bed. These signs are easy to dismiss as a callus, a fungal infection, or “just a bruise” — which is exactly why foot cancer is so often caught late. This guide walks through the earliest signs, what actually causes it, who’s at higher risk, and what treatment really looks like if a diagnosis is confirmed.

“Foot cancer” isn’t one disease — it’s an umbrella term for several different cancers that can develop in the skin, soft tissue, bone, or nail unit of the foot and ankle. Some start locally; others are cancers elsewhere in the body that show up on the foot as a secondary sign. Because the feet take daily wear and tear, an abnormal spot or wound is often waved off as a routine podiatric annoyance, and that delay is where the real danger lies.

The Main Types of Foot Cancer

  • Melanoma – the most serious skin cancer, and the one most associated with feet. Around half of all foot melanomas appear as a type called acral lentiginous melanoma (ALM), which often shows up on the sole or under a toenail rather than in a sun-exposed spot. Melanoma is a striking example of how a rare cancer can carry outsized risk: it accounts for only a small share of all skin cancer diagnoses overall, yet is responsible for the large majority of skin-cancer-related deaths, which is exactly why speed of diagnosis matters so much with this particular type.
  • Squamous cell carcinoma (SCC) – the most common skin cancer found on the foot. It often starts as a scaly, inflamed bump that can be mistaken for a plantar wart, a callus, or a fungal patch. SCC has a well-documented link to areas of chronic irritation — old scars, long-standing ulcers, and areas of persistent inflammation are all considered higher-risk sites.
  • Basal cell carcinoma (BCC) – less common on the feet, slower-growing, but still needs early treatment. It can look like a pearly bump or an open sore that doesn’t heal.
  • Soft tissue sarcoma – develops in the muscle, fat, or connective tissue of the foot or ankle. It frequently starts as a painless lump, which makes it easy to ignore until it grows.
  • Bone cancer (osteosarcoma and related tumors) – rarer, and more often seen in younger patients. It typically presents with swelling, deep pain, or even a fracture that happens with minimal trauma. A small number of bone cancers are linked to inherited genetic syndromes or prior radiation exposure, though for most cases no clear cause is ever identified.
  • Kaposi sarcoma – linked to immune system suppression, this can appear on the feet as purple-red patches or nodules and is more likely in people who are immunocompromised.

The earliest indicators are usually small, painless, and easy to explain away — which is exactly why they’re worth learning to spot deliberately rather than waiting to “notice” them by accident.

The Earliest, Most Subtle Clues

  • A new dark spot, or an old mole that looks slightly “off” – not necessarily dramatic, sometimes just a mole that seems to have grown a little, or gained an extra shade of color, since the last time you looked.
  • A faint streak under a toenail – often mistaken for a bruise from an ill-fitting shoe, especially if you can’t recall a specific injury that would explain it.
  • A small scaly or rough patch that resembles dry skin or the start of a fungal infection, but doesn’t improve with moisturizer or antifungal cream after a couple of weeks.
  • A pinpoint sore that scabs, heals a little, then reopens in the same spot — a cycle that’s easy to mistake for a healing wound that keeps getting irritated by a shoe.
  • A tiny, firm lump you can feel but barely see, with no pain and no obvious cause, often first noticed by touch rather than sight.
  • Persistent itching in one specific spot on the skin of the foot with no rash or visible cause.

Early Signs vs. Advanced Signs

Early-stage foot cancer signs tend to be flat, small, and painless. As they progress without treatment, they typically become more pronounced: the lesion may thicken, bleed or ooze more readily, grow noticeably larger, or start to cause pain, swelling, or a change in how you walk. The gap between “early” and “advanced” can be a matter of months, which is the entire argument for treating the subtle version seriously rather than waiting for the obvious version to show up.

Understanding why foot cancer develops helps explain why some of the usual sun-safety advice doesn’t fully apply here — and why a handful of foot-specific causes deserve their own attention.

UV Radiation — A Smaller Piece of the Puzzle Than You’d Think

Sun exposure is a genuine cause of skin cancer on the tops of the feet, particularly for people who wear open sandals regularly. But it explains only part of the picture. The sole of the foot and the skin under a toenail — the two most common sites for foot melanoma — get essentially no sun exposure, which means UV damage isn’t the driving cause there. This is one of the most persistent misconceptions about foot cancer: many people assume “no sun, no risk,” when the opposite is closer to true for the areas where foot melanoma most often appears.

Chronic Irritation and Inflammation

Long-standing wounds, burn scars, and areas of repeated friction or pressure are a recognized cause of squamous cell carcinoma developing directly within that damaged tissue. This is sometimes described as a cancer arising in a site of chronic injury — the skin’s repeated repair process, over years, occasionally goes wrong. It’s part of why an old scar or a chronically cracked heel that suddenly starts changing shouldn’t be dismissed as “just how it’s always been.”

Viral and Immune-Related Causes

Certain foot skin cancers are linked to viral exposure rather than sun damage, and immune suppression — whether from a medical condition or certain medications — raises the risk of specific types like Kaposi sarcoma. This is a reminder that “foot cancer” isn’t a single mechanism with a single cause; different types arise through genuinely different pathways.

Genetic and Inherited Factors

A small proportion of bone cancers, including some that affect the foot and ankle, are linked to inherited genetic syndromes or a family history of certain cancers. Prior radiation exposure — for example, from earlier cancer treatment elsewhere in the body — is another recognized contributing factor for bone cancer specifically.

An Emerging, Less-Discussed Cause: The Diabetes Connection

This is the piece most general foot-cancer content skips, but it’s directly relevant here. Some clinical literature has explored whether diabetes independently raises skin cancer risk — not only through the more obvious mechanism of chronic wounds and inflammation, but potentially also linked to certain long-term medications used to manage common diabetes comorbidities. This research area is still developing and isn’t a reason for alarm, but it reinforces why routine, professional foot exams are worth prioritizing if you have diabetes, rather than relying purely on self-checks.

In Many Cases, There’s No Single Identifiable Cause

It’s worth being honest about this: for a meaningful number of foot cancers, particularly bone and soft tissue tumors, no clear cause is ever identified. Risk factors raise or lower the odds, but they don’t fully explain who does and doesn’t develop these cancers — which is exactly why symptom awareness matters as much as risk-factor awareness.

Not everyone faces the same odds, and knowing where you fall on the risk spectrum helps you decide how closely to monitor your feet.

Established Risk Factors

  • Age – risk generally rises with age, though bone cancers of the foot are an exception and skew toward younger patients.
  • Fair skin and UV exposure – classic risk factors for melanoma, SCC, and BCC, even though feet are rarely thought of as “sun-exposed” skin.
  • Chronic wounds, scars, or inflammation – long-standing ulcers, burn scars, or areas of repeated irritation are recognized risk sites for squamous cell carcinoma developing within them.
  • Immune suppression – conditions or medications that weaken the immune system raise the risk of several skin cancer types, including Kaposi sarcoma.
  • Family history and genetic syndromes – a family history of melanoma, or rare inherited syndromes, can elevate risk for skin and bone cancers respectively.
  • Diabetes – both through the chronic-wound pathway and, per emerging research, potentially as an independent factor worth discussing with your care team.

Because foot cancer rarely “announces” itself with dramatic symptoms, the details matter. Here’s what specialists tell people to look for once a spot has moved beyond the earliest, subtlest stage described above.

Skin Changes and Mole Warning Signs

The ABCDE rule is the simplest way to evaluate a mole or dark spot on the foot:

  • Asymmetry – one half doesn’t match the other
  • Border – edges are ragged, blurred, or irregular
  • Color – more than one shade of brown, black, red, or blue within the same spot
  • Diameter – larger than about 6 millimeters (roughly the size of a pencil eraser)
  • Evolution – any change in size, shape, color, or texture over weeks or months

A related checklist — CUBED — is also useful for lesions that don’t look like a typical mole: is it Colored differently from the surrounding skin, Uncertain in diagnosis, Bleeding or leaking fluid, Enlarging, or firm/Deep? Any “yes” answer is worth a professional look.

A crucial caveat: acral lentiginous melanoma — the type most common on the sole and under the toenail — frequently does not follow the classic ABCDE pattern. Its unusual location and atypical appearance are a well-documented reason this type in particular gets misdiagnosed or caught late. This is precisely why “it doesn’t look like the pictures I’ve seen of melanoma” isn’t a reliable reason to rule it out on a foot.

Non-Healing Sores, Ulcers, and Wounds

A sore, ulcer, or patch that hasn’t closed up after several weeks — despite basic care — is one of the most consistently reported warning signs across skin cancers of the foot. Clinical guidance for evaluating a stubborn foot ulcer generally points toward a biopsy when the wound doesn’t fit the usual pattern of trauma, poor circulation, or nerve-related damage, when it fails to respond to standard treatment, or when the wound tissue looks unusual — for example, showing pigmentation or unusual granulation.

Lumps, Swelling, and Persistent Pain

A firm lump under the skin, unexplained swelling that doesn’t follow an injury, or foot pain that doesn’t improve with rest, better footwear, or standard treatment all warrant attention — particularly if the lump is painless and keeps slowly growing, which is a classic early pattern for soft tissue sarcoma.

Nail and Toenail Changes

Dark streaks, unexplained discoloration, or a change in the shape and texture of a toenail — especially when there’s no history of an injury to that nail — can be a sign of subungual (under-the-nail) melanoma. This is one of the most frequently missed presentations of foot cancer, because it’s so easily mistaken for a fungal infection or old bruising that never faded.

Two things work against early detection here. First, almost nobody examines the soles of their feet or the skin between their toes the way they’d check their face or arms — so a changing mole on the sole can go unnoticed for a long time. Second, the feet are host to a long list of common, harmless problems — calluses, corns, plantar warts, fungal infections, blisters — that can look deceptively similar to something more serious. A scaly patch that looks like athlete’s foot but doesn’t respond to antifungal treatment, for instance, deserves a second look rather than a stronger cream.

There’s a well-documented, specific version of this problem in diabetes care: medical case reports describe melanoma being initially diagnosed and treated as a routine diabetic foot ulcer, sometimes for months, because the two can look remarkably alike on the surface. In these cases, the wound simply didn’t improve with standard ulcer care — which is often the only outward clue that something else is going on. Clinicians are increasingly advised to consider a biopsy for any foot ulcer that doesn’t fit the typical diabetic ulcer profile or doesn’t respond to therapy as expected, precisely to catch these look-alike cases earlier.

For people managing diabetes, there’s an added layer of risk that general foot-cancer articles rarely mention. Diabetic peripheral neuropathy reduces sensation in the feet, which means pain — often the body’s earliest alarm — may simply not register the way it would elsewhere. A lump, sore, or ulcer that would normally prompt an immediate reaction can go unnoticed for weeks because it doesn’t hurt.

Distinguishing a Diabetic Ulcer From a Suspicious Lesion

Diabetic foot ulcers and cancerous lesions can look superficially similar — both may appear as open sores that heal slowly — but they behave differently:

  • A typical diabetic ulcer usually forms over a pressure point (like the ball of the foot or a bony prominence) and is linked to friction, poor circulation, or nerve damage.
  • A cancerous lesion can appear anywhere, including areas with no pressure or friction, and is more likely to show irregular borders, uneven color, or a texture that doesn’t match a standard wound.
  • A wound that has none of the usual risk factors behind it — no significant trauma, reasonably controlled blood sugar, and no obvious circulation or nerve-damage explanation — is one that clinicians are advised to investigate further rather than treat as routine.
  • Any sore — diabetic or not — that hasn’t shown real improvement after several weeks of proper wound care should be reassessed rather than simply re-dressed.

This is exactly why routine, professional foot checks matter more for people with diabetes than for the general population: reduced sensation removes the “it hurts, so I’ll look at it” safety net that most people rely on without realizing it. It’s also worth being clear about what the data does and doesn’t say: diabetic foot ulcers themselves carry serious health risks — primarily tied to cardiovascular disease and infection, not cancer — and the vast majority of diabetic ulcers are exactly what they appear to be. The point isn’t to cause alarm about every wound; it’s that the small subset of ulcers that don’t behave like typical diabetic ulcers deserve a closer look, because that’s where cancer cases hide in the data.

Quick Self-Examination Checklist

Once a month, in good light — ideally with a handheld mirror or your phone’s camera to check the sole and between the toes — go through:

  1. The soles of both feet, including the arch
  2. Between every toe
  3. The tops of the feet and ankles
  4. Every toenail, including the nail bed and surrounding skin
  5. Any existing mole, scar, or old wound for changes since your last check

A useful habit: photograph anything you’re unsure about, with today’s date. A month from now, you’ll have an objective comparison instead of relying on memory — which is often how early changes get missed.

If anything matches the ABCDE or CUBED signs above, or a sore hasn’t healed in two to three weeks, book an appointment rather than waiting for it to resolve on its own.

What Happens During a Professional Foot Cancer Screening

A specialist will visually examine the lesion or wound, take a detailed history (including any family history of skin cancer, prior wounds, and how the current issue has changed over time), and, if needed, arrange a skin biopsy or imaging such as an MRI to determine whether the tissue is cancerous and, if so, what type and stage it is. For people with diabetes, this is often combined with a broader foot health check, since neuropathy and circulation issues affect wound healing and risk in general.

Treatment for foot cancer depends heavily on the type, how deep or advanced it is, and where exactly it’s located — but a few general principles hold across most cases.

Diagnosis and Staging Come First

Diagnosis starts with a biopsy — a small tissue sample examined under a microscope — sometimes paired with imaging to check whether anything has spread beyond the original site. For melanoma specifically, the depth of the lesion (how far it has grown into the skin) is one of the most important factors doctors use to judge severity and plan treatment, alongside whether it has reached nearby lymph nodes. This staging process determines everything that follows, which is part of why waiting even a few extra weeks to get a changing mole checked can genuinely change the treatment path available.

Surgery Is Usually the First and Main Treatment

For early-stage skin cancers — melanoma, SCC, and BCC caught before they’ve spread — surgical removal of the lesion is typically the primary treatment, and for early-stage melanoma specifically, surgery alone is often the only treatment needed, with very high cure rates. Depending on the case, a sentinel lymph node biopsy may be done alongside the excision to check whether the cancer has reached nearby lymph nodes, which helps confirm the stage and guide any further treatment.

When Cancer Has Spread: Systemic Treatment Options

For melanoma that has spread beyond the original site (typically Stage III or IV), treatment has shifted heavily toward systemic therapies — drugs that work throughout the body rather than treating one spot:

  • Immunotherapy – checkpoint inhibitor drugs that help the immune system recognize and attack cancer cells; this has become a standard option for advanced melanoma, sometimes used before surgery to shrink a tumor first.
  • Targeted therapy – drugs aimed at specific genetic mutations that drive some melanomas (notably the BRAF mutation, present in roughly half of cutaneous melanomas), used when genetic testing shows the tumor carries a targetable mutation.
  • Radiation therapy – used either as a standalone treatment or after surgery, and sometimes for recurrences in a specific area.
  • Chemotherapy – now used less often than immunotherapy or targeted therapy for melanoma specifically, but still relevant for certain cases or when other treatments aren’t effective.

Treatment for Sarcomas and Bone Tumors

Soft tissue sarcomas and bone cancers of the foot typically involve a combination of surgery and, depending on the case, radiation or chemotherapy, with the specific combination guided by the tumor type, size, and whether it has spread.

Follow-Up Care Matters Just as Much as Initial Treatment

Regardless of type or stage, ongoing follow-up — regular skin and lymph node checks, and continued monitoring of the treated area — is a standard part of care afterward, since catching a recurrence early carries the same advantages as catching the original cancer early.

Don’t Skip Sunscreen on Your Feet

Sun exposure is a real risk factor for foot melanoma, particularly on the tops of the feet in open sandals. Sunscreen on exposed foot skin is as relevant as it is on your face and arms — most people just forget it.

Treat Chronic Cracks, Calluses, and Old Scars as Worth Watching

Because areas of long-term irritation are a recognized risk factor for squamous cell carcinoma, keeping cracked heels and thick calluses properly managed isn’t just about comfort — it’s one small way to reduce a genuine risk factor over time. If an old scar or long-standing callused area starts changing texture, color, or shape, treat that as a signal rather than “just how it’s always looked.”

Make Foot Checks a Habit, Not a One-Time Thing

A monthly self-check takes under two minutes and is the single most effective early-detection habit available to you. For anyone with diabetes, neuropathy, or a personal or family history of skin cancer, a periodic professional foot exam adds a layer of protection that self-checks alone can’t fully replace — precisely because it removes reliance on pain as a warning signal.

1. Is foot cancer common?

No — cancers of the foot and ankle are considered rare compared to skin cancers on more sun-exposed areas like the face or arms. But because the feet are so rarely checked, foot cancers are often diagnosed at a later, more advanced stage than cancers found elsewhere on the body.

2. Does foot cancer always hurt?

Not necessarily. Many foot cancers, including early melanoma and soft tissue sarcoma, are painless in their initial stages. This is a key reason people delay seeking care — and why relying on pain alone as a warning sign isn’t reliable, especially for people with reduced foot sensation from neuropathy.

3. Can a foot cancer symptom look like a normal wart or callus?

Yes. Squamous cell carcinoma in particular can resemble a plantar wart, a thickened callus, or a fungal infection. If a “wart” or scaly patch doesn’t respond to standard treatment within a few weeks, it’s worth having it properly evaluated rather than continuing to self-treat.

4. What does melanoma on the foot usually look like?

It commonly appears as a new dark spot or a mole that changes in size, shape, or color, and it often develops on the sole of the foot or under a toenail — areas people rarely inspect. Around a third of foot melanomas can also appear pink or red rather than the dark brown or black most people expect, and the sole/under-nail type frequently doesn’t follow the standard ABCDE pattern at all, which adds to how often it’s missed.

5. Why should people with diabetes be especially careful about foot cancer symptoms?

Diabetic neuropathy can reduce or eliminate pain sensation in the feet, so a developing lesion or sore may not trigger the discomfort that would normally prompt someone to check it. There are also documented cases of melanoma being mistaken for a routine diabetic foot ulcer because the two can look similar on the surface. Combined with slower wound healing, this makes routine professional foot exams — not just self-checks — an important part of diabetes foot care.

6. How is a diabetic foot ulcer told apart from a cancerous lesion?

Location and behavior are the main clues. A typical diabetic ulcer sits over a pressure point and has a clear explanation — friction, circulation issues, or nerve damage. A wound that appears without those usual risk factors, doesn’t improve with proper wound care after several weeks, or looks unusual (irregular pigmentation, odd tissue texture) is one that specialists generally recommend investigating further, sometimes with a biopsy, rather than continuing standard ulcer treatment indefinitely.

7. What causes foot cancer if it’s not sun exposure?

It depends on the type. Squamous cell carcinoma is often linked to chronic irritation in scars or long-standing wounds; some skin cancers have viral or immune-related causes; bone cancers are occasionally linked to genetics or prior radiation; and for a meaningful share of cases, especially bone and soft tissue tumors, no single clear cause is ever identified.

8. Is surgery always required for foot cancer?

For early-stage skin cancers, surgical removal is usually the main and often only treatment needed, with excellent outcomes. For cancer that has spread, treatment typically expands to include systemic options like immunotherapy, targeted therapy, radiation, or chemotherapy, tailored to the specific type and stage.

9. What should I do if I find a suspicious spot on my foot?

Photograph it with today’s date for reference, avoid picking at it or self-treating it as a wart or fungal infection without a diagnosis, and book an evaluation with a foot specialist. Early-stage skin cancers are highly treatable, and a proper diagnosis — via visual exam and biopsy if needed — is the only reliable way to know what you’re dealing with.
